About this map

The Genesee River cuts through this high-relief landscape in Potter County, Pennsylvania, where traditional settlement patterns follow the winding valleys. The village of Ulysses serves as a primary hub in the southeast corner, distinguished by the Old Lewisville Cem and the Ulysses Cem. Moving north and west along the river and its tributaries, small communities like West Bingham, Hickox, and Genesee mark the intersections of rural routes like Gold Rd and Hickox Rd. The presence of Hallock Burying Ground Cem and Daniels Cem tucked into the hollows provides specific points of interest for genealogists tracing local families in this border region. The terrain is defined by prominent elevations like Cobb Hill and Rag Hill, separated by deep drainage features such as Wolf Hollow and Musto Hollow that dictate the path of the secondary road network connecting to North Bingham and the New York state line.
